Abstract

This study aims: To determine the application of the murabaha contract system to microfinance at BRI Syariah KCP Palopo; This type of research is field research using qualitative research methods. The data analysis technique used is descriptive analysis and SWOT analysis is measured by interviews to determine the overall internal and external factors of microfinance at BRI Syariah KCP Palopo. The results of research in the field show that 1) The application of the murabaha contract system in microfinance at BRI Syariah performs one contract first, the first is done with a wakalah contract, then continues with a murabaha contract. 2) Provision of microfinance using a murabaha contract has an influence on MSME business development in terms of business capital, turnover, income, number of products and expansion of the location of the business. 3) In the process of providing microfinance to MSME customers, BRI Syariah experienced obstacles such as a lack of understanding by customers about contracts and products, and the ineffectiveness of using business capital. From the results of the SWOT analysis based on the identification of internal factors and external factors on Micro Financing Products at BRI Syariah KCP Palopo, namely creating strategies to overcome weaknesses and threats and increase strengths and opportunities, one of which is BRI Syariah introducing sharia bank products to MSMEs to increasing interest in taking financing at BRI Syariah KCP Palopo.
